Tom's Hospital (TomsHospital.com) is an online platform where you can get medical consultations across 15+ specialties, from cardiology and oncology to psychiatry and pediatrics. You describe symptoms or upload health reports, and the system returns clear guidance based on WHO standards. It runs 24/7 and is positioned for users in the EU, UK, USA, Canada, and Australia who want quick answers without waiting on an appointment.

The platform also draws on major clinical guidelines beyond WHO, including AHA and ESMO protocols. It can walk you through first-aid steps during an emergency while you wait for professional help. The team behind it reports more than 100,000 health reports analyzed to date.

Tom's Hospital is built for anyone who wants to understand symptoms, decode lab results, or prepare questions before a real doctor visit. It does not replace in-person exams, diagnoses, or prescriptions. The site states it is a SaaS platform, not classified as Software as a Medical Device (SaMD).

Chris Thomas founded the project. The service markets itself as SOC 2 and GDPR compliant, with encrypted chats and reports that are not shared externally.

FAQs:

How much does Tom's Hospital cost?

Tom's Hospital charges $19 per month for its monthly plan or $150 per year for unlimited AI medical consultations across 15 specialties plus blood report analysis. Both plans include a 24-hour refund window after activation.

Does Tom's Hospital have a free plan?

No. Tom's Hospital is subscription-only. You choose either the $19 monthly plan or the $150 yearly all-access plan on the pricing page before starting consultations.

Does Tom's Hospital replace a real doctor?

No. Tom's Hospital provides medical guidance, symptom clarity, and report explanations, but it does not diagnose conditions or prescribe treatments. The site recommends it as a companion before or after seeing a licensed physician.

Is Tom's Hospital classified as a medical device?

No. Tom's Hospital states it is a SaaS platform and is not classified as Software as a Medical Device (SaMD). It offers AI-driven health guidance while following SOC 2 and GDPR standards for data security.

What medical specialties does Tom's Hospital cover?

Tom's Hospital covers 15+ specialties including cardiology, dentistry, ENT, gastroenterology, gynecology, nephrology, neurology, nutrition, oncology, ophthalmology, orthopedics, pediatrics, psychiatry, psychology, and rheumatology.

Is my health data private on Tom's Hospital?

Tom's Hospital says chats and uploaded reports are encrypted and never shared. The platform advertises SOC 2 and GDPR compliance for its data handling practices.

What countries can use Tom's Hospital?

Tom's Hospital markets its yearly subscription as valid in all countries, explicitly naming the USA, UK, Canada, and Australia. The homepage also highlights trust across the EU, UK, USA, Canada, and Australia.
